Private Concerts at Your Home or Business
​Enjoy a concert at your home or business with the very best musicians in the DC-Baltimore region. We started holding concerts in people's yards in 2020 as a way to provide live music safely and legally during the pandemic while providing a much needed source of income to professional musicians who had few other places to play live. The bands went house to house and the concerts were a big hit. Now we are offering both outdoor and indoor concerts for your home or office or special event such as a wedding or anniversary.
